Default Orlando Airport Update

I had recently made a post asking if Orlando Airport was busy and what vendors were open and many of you kindly responded. I have since taken my trip and have returned. Here is what I observed......

They say per CDC, masks should be worn at all times while in the airport, so we wore masks. The airport was not busy. TSA was an easy do and we didn’t have to wait in lines to get through.....just 1-2 people ahead of us....we got at the airport at 12:15 for a 2:00 pm flight.

There were food vendors open, some have shut down. We found the selection enough to satisfy our needs. While eating, we were able to take our masks off. Some people were sitting in areas with few people in them and had their masks off.

We flew South West. They didn’t have people line up as they usually do when waiting to board. They called people up 5-10 at a time. We were instructed to wear our masks throughout the flight. They did serve ice water and a package of snacks. We took our masks off to eat and drink, and after we finished we put them back on. Our flight out of Orlando to Raleigh, NC had 86 people on it. We were spaced out more than adequately.

On the return trip to Orlando, our plane had more people...I’d say 100-120. That still left the middle seats open and some rows had nobody in them. They flight crew told us that if the middle seat was needed, we were to use if needed. At this busier time, South West does not leave the middle seat open as they did earlier with Covid. The return flight crew told us they were serving light snacks and asked us to put our masks back on in between bites. For us, that was ridiculous, so we kept our masks off for the duration of eating our snacks......nobody said anything.

I must say that with all of the precautions taken when loading and seating, it basically did no good because when deplaning, everyone was once again on top of each other. Makes no sense to follow all of those precautions and then everyone get with inches of each other to get off the plane...🤷*♀️

Also, when reading getting on South West’s website, they say they spray disinfectant and anti-microbial spray on every surface, every night. That procedure only benefits the first flight out. After that, nothing is wiped down. If you fly that afternoon, you really don’t benefit from the cleaning done the night before, as by then hundreds of people have already flown. So, I continue to bring Lysol wipes and wipe down everything from the seat to the air flow vents. Don’t be misled by thinking they spray and disinfect after each flight....they don’t. With that said, I appreciate the fact that they are taking extra precautions with a Covid. We felt comfortable flying and will most likely fly again in the Spring.
